Digital banking in Mombasa is shaped by the city's unique economic role and fintech scene.

Mombasa's fintech adoption is driven by M-Pesa's dominance and a growing trade finance technology sector, with a startup ecosystem benefiting from proximity to Nairobi's tech scene. Mombasa is Kenya's second city and East Africa's busiest port, handling the majority of trade for Kenya, Uganda, Rwanda, and DRC, with a major tourism and hospitality economy. The primary banking need in Mombasa: kES and M-Pesa accounts, port trade finance, and personal banking for Mombasa's large Arab-African Swahili business community and international tourism workers.
